Q: What are GTA V hidden cars?

A: GTA V hidden cars are rare or unique vehicles that do not spawn commonly in the game world. They are often found in specific locations, under certain conditions, or at particular times, making them sought-after by players looking for exclusive additions to their collection.

Q: Where can I find the rarest hidden cars in GTA V?

A: The rarest hidden cars in GTA V are often found in secluded or specific areas. For instance, the Dubsta 2 can appear in Vinewood Hills at certain times, the Hearse near churches, and unique off-road vehicles in Blaine County's deserts or mountains. Fort Zancudo also harbors military vehicles, though acquiring them is a challenge.

Q: How do I acquire a GTA V hidden car once I find it?

A: Once you locate a GTA V hidden car, you typically need to steal it. In Story Mode, simply drive it to a character's garage to save it. In GTA Online, you must drive it to a personal garage, add a tracker, and purchase insurance to make it permanently yours. Some special vehicles might require specific mission completions.

Q: Are there any specific times of day to find certain hidden cars?

A: Yes, many GTA V hidden cars have specific spawn windows. For example, the rare Dubsta 2 variant is known to spawn more frequently between 7:00 AM and 5:00 PM in-game time in certain Vinewood Hills parking lots. Monitoring the in-game clock is crucial for successful rare car hunting.

Q: Can all hidden cars be customized and modified?

A: Most civilian hidden cars found in GTA V can be customized and modified at Los Santos Customs, just like regular vehicles. This includes paint jobs, engine upgrades, armor, and more. However, certain military or special mission vehicles might have limited or no customization options available.

Q: Is it harder to find hidden cars in GTA Online compared to Story Mode?

A: Finding hidden cars can be both easier and harder in GTA Online. It's harder due to potential interference from other players and stricter despawn mechanics. However, it can also be easier as some spawn methods, like 'session hopping' or influencing traffic with specific vehicles, are more viable in the online environment, creating opportunities for dedicated hunters.

Q: What should I do if a hidden car isn't spawning at its known location?

A: If a hidden car isn't spawning, first verify all conditions: time, weather, and your current vehicle. Try leaving the area and returning, or changing your in-game session. Persistence is key; rare spawns often require multiple attempts. Sometimes, driving a similar class of vehicle to the spawn area can help trigger its appearance.

What Makes a Car a GTA V Hidden Car?

In Grand Theft Auto V, a "hidden car" typically refers to a vehicle that doesn't regularly spawn in common areas or can only be found under specific conditions, locations, or at certain times. These aren't your everyday street cars; they're often rare, unique variants, or even highly customized versions that offer superior performance or aesthetics. Think of them as Easter eggs on wheels, rewarding explorers and dedicated players. Where Can I Start Looking for GTA V Hidden Cars?

The vast world of Los Santos and Blaine County is dotted with potential hidden car spawns. A great starting point is exploring less-traveled roads, secluded areas, and specific points of interest that might seem insignificant at first glance. Locations like the military base (Fort Zancudo), the Vinewood Hills mansions, the docks, and even certain rural junkyards are notorious for spawning unusual vehicles. Often, these areas are either restricted or require a bit of tricky navigation, adding to the challenge and exclusivity. Remember, some cars only appear during specific in-game times, so a bit of patience and strategic timing can pay off big time.

Are There Any Specific GTA V Hidden Cars Known for Rare Spawns?

Absolutely! Several vehicles are well-known among veteran players for their elusive nature. The **Dune Buggy** sometimes appears near the Senora Desert, particularly around Sandy Shores. The **Dubsta 2**, a rare SUV with unique chrome accents, is a highly sought-after variant often found in specific Vinewood Hills locations during certain hours, particularly when driving a similar SUV. Then there's the **Mesa (Merryweather variant)**, which you can often acquire during specific missions or by carefully provoking Merryweather security. Even the **Hearse** is a rare find, usually appearing near churches in certain neighborhoods when driven by another player. These aren't just vehicles; they're trophies.

How Do Time and Weather Affect Hidden Car Spawns in GTA V?

Time and weather are crucial factors for many GTA V hidden car spawns, adding a layer of realism and complexity. Some vehicles, like the aforementioned Dubsta 2, have a higher chance of appearing between specific in-game hours, often late morning or early afternoon. Certain unique vehicles might also appear more frequently during particular weather conditions, although this is less common than time-based spawns. For instance, some rare off-roaders might be more prevalent during rainy weather in mountainous regions, making the terrain more challenging and appropriate for their capabilities. Always keep an eye on your in-game clock and weather reports if you're seriously hunting for a specific rare car.

What Strategies Can I Use to Maximize My Chances of Finding Rare Cars?

To maximize your chances, employ a systematic approach. First, research the specific hidden car you're after; knowing its usual spawn points and conditions is half the battle. Second, try **session hopping** in GTA Online if a car is public spawn based; changing sessions can reset vehicle spawns. Third, drive a similar vehicle to the one you're hunting; this can sometimes trigger a rarer variant to appear in traffic (e.g., driving a Dubsta to find a Dubsta 2). Fourth, be persistent and patient. Many of these finds require multiple attempts or specific timings. Finally, always have a **Garage available** to store your new prize immediately after acquisition to prevent despawns.

Can I Keep GTA V Hidden Cars Permanently in My Garage?

Yes, for the most part, you can absolutely keep GTA V hidden cars permanently in your garage, whether you're playing in Story Mode or GTA Online. In Story Mode, simply drive the car to any character's personal garage. In GTA Online, you'll need to drive it into one of your owned properties' garages, or a custom auto shop to add a tracker and insurance.
